Frederic W. Farrar, an esteemed Doctor of Divinity, Fellow of the Royal Society, and late fellow of Trinity College, Cambridge, breathes life into the story of Christ in this comprehensive work. As a chaplain to the Queen and Canon of Westminster, Farrars faith is unquestionable. Delving into the life, death, and resurrection of Christ, Farrar illustrates the miracles of Christ without shying away, presenting Him as the ultimate lawgiver of nature. A scholar with intimate knowledge of Biblical Greek, Latin and other languages, Farrars first-hand experience of the Holy Land and vast studies, including Jewish sources, enrich his account. The book is a beautiful retelling of Christs life, filled with deep religious insights and contextual observations. Although footnotes from the print text are not included here, the exhaustive research underpinning this work will satisfy even the most meticulous scholar. Heralded as a timeless classic among religious scholars, The Life of Christ offers enlightenment to believers and non-believers alike.
